Description We are looking for a detail-oriented Front Desk Coordinator to join our team on a contract basis in Brunswick, Ohio.
In this role, you will serve as the first point of contact for visitors and clients, ensuring a welcoming and organized experience.
Your organizational skills and ability to manage multiple tasks will play a key role in supporting the smooth operation of our front desk.
Responsibilities: - Greet visitors and clients warmly, ensuring a positive first impression.
- Answer and manage multi-line phone systems, directing calls to the appropriate departments.
- Maintain organized filing systems for records and documentation.
- Perform data entry tasks with accuracy and attention to detail.
- Provide administrative support, including scheduling and coordinating appointments.
- Assist with concierge services to address client or visitor needs.
- Respond to inquiries and provide information about the organization.
- Utilize Microsoft Word, Excel, and Outlook for various administrative tasks.
- Collaborate with team members to ensure front desk operations run smoothly.
- Handle incoming and outgoing mail and deliveries efficiently.
Requirements - Proven experience in a front desk or administrative role.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Word, Excel, and Outlook.
- Strong customer service skills with a focus on being detail oriented.
- Ability to manage and operate a multi-line phone system.
- Excellent organizational and file management abilities.
- Strong interpersonal skills for effective communication.
- Attention to detail and accuracy in data entry.
- Ability to prioritize tasks and handle multiple responsibilities effectively.
